What Does a Car Locksmith Do?

A car locksmith focuses on automotive security. They are trained to deal with a wide variety of concerns connected to locks, keys, and security systems in cars. Here are some of the primary services they provide:

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ication

    • Lost or Stolen Keys: If a car owner loses their keys, a locksmith can produce a new set utilizing the vehicle's unique key code or by translating the lock.
    • Replicate Keys: Creating an extra set of keys for benefit or for member of the family.
  2. Key Extraction

    • Broken Keys: Sometimes keys break off inside the lock. A car locksmith has the expertise to securely extract the broken key without damaging the lock.
  3. Lock Repair and Replacement

    • Damaged Locks: If a car lock is damaged due to wear and tear or a tried break-in, a locksmith can repair or replace it.
    • Rekeying: Changing the internal pins of a lock to make it work with a brand-new set of keys, making sure the old keys no longer work.
  4. High-Security Key Services

    • Transponder Keys: Modern vehicles often utilize transponder keys, which have a chip that communicates with the car's security system. Car locksmith professionals can program and replace these keys.
    • Remote Car Keys: Repairing or changing remote car keys, consisting of those with integrated keyless entry systems.
  5. Car Lockout Assistance

    • Emergency situation Lockout: If you lock yourself out of your car, a locksmith can quickly and safely open the vehicle.
    • Trunk Lockout: Assistance with unlocking the trunk if you unintentionally lock your keys inside.
  6. Ignition Repair and Replacement

    • Damaged Ignitions: Over time, the ignition switch can wear out, making it tough to start the car. A locksmith can repair or replace the ignition switch.
  7. Keyless Entry Systems

    • Installation and Programming: Installing and programming keyless entry systems for added benefit and security.
  8. Vehicle Security Consultation

    • Security Assessments: Providing guidance on boosting the security of your vehicle, including recommendations for additional locks or alarms.

Tools of the Trade

Car locksmiths use a variety of specialized tools to perform their jobs efficiently and effectively. Here are some of the vital tools in their toolbox:

  • Key Cutting Machines: These makers can duplicate keys quickly and properly.
  • Lock Decoder: A device utilized to determine the key code for a lock.
  • Lock Picking Tools: For emergency situation lockouts, locksmith professionals use these tools to open locks without causing damage.
  • Transponder Key Programmer: This gadget is utilized to program transponder keys to work with a car's security system.
  • Laser Key Cutting Machine: For high-precision key cutting, particularly for intricate key styles.
  • Ignition Cylinder Puller: A tool utilized to remove the ignition cylinder for repair or replacement.
  • Pin Extractors: Used to eliminate broken pins from locks during repairs.

FAQs About Car Locksmiths

Q: How do I find a credible car locksmith?

  • A: Look for locksmith professionals with certifications from expert companies such as the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). Read online reviews and request referrals from good friends or family. Constantly inspect for a license and insurance coverage before hiring a locksmith.

Q: Can a car locksmith open my car without damaging it?

  • A: Yes, professional car locksmith professionals utilize specialized tools and strategies to open locks without causing damage. They are trained to deal with a variety of lock types and can generally acquire access to your vehicle rapidly and safely.

Q: How long does it require to have a new key made?

  • A: The time it requires to make a new key depends upon the type of key and the intricacy of the lock. Simple key duplications can take just a few minutes, while transponder key programming may take longer, frequently 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Is it legal to have a locksmith make a key for my car?

  • A: Yes, it is legal as long as you can show ownership of the vehicle. Many locksmith professionals will need identification and a legitimate factor for requiring a brand-new key.

Q: Can car locksmith professionals program contemporary keyless entry systems?

  • A: Yes, many car locksmiths are equipped to program and install keyless entry systems. They have the required tools and knowledge to guarantee that your brand-new system works seamlessly with your vehicle.

The Future of Car Locksmithing

As innovation advances, the function of the car locksmith is developing. Modern cars are significantly equipped with advanced security systems, including keyless entry and clever key technology. Car locksmiths are continually updating their abilities and acquiring brand-new tools to keep up with these improvements. Here are some patterns to view:

  • Increased Use of Smart Technology: More automobiles are featuring incorporated wise systems that can be accessed via smart devices or other gadgets.
  • Biometric Locks: Some high-end lorries are explore biometric locks, such as fingerprint or facial acknowledgment, which will require customized understanding from locksmith professionals.
  • Remote Services: With the increase of mobile technology, car locksmiths are providing more remote services, such as key programming by means of mobile phone apps.
